Project build fails in RHPAM 7.5.0 / RHDM 7.5.0 due to missing mvel2 artifact
Issue
-
Executing a maven build with a dependency on Drools from the RHDM 7.5.0 version fails due to a missing dependency:
Could not resolve dependencies for project com.redhat.gss:simple-drools-test:jar:1.0-SNAPSHOT: Failed to collect dependencies at org.drools:drools-core:jar:7.26.0.Final-redhat-00005 -> org.kie.soup:kie-soup-project-datamodel-commons:jar:7.26.0.Final-redhat-00005 -> org.mvel:mvel2:jar:2.3.2.Final-redhat-1: Failed to read artifact descriptor for org.mvel:mvel2:jar:2.3.2.Final-redhat-1: Could not transfer artifact org.mvel:mvel2:pom:2.3.2.Final-redhat-1 from/to central (https://repo.maven.apache.org/maven2): repo.maven.apache.org: Name or service not known: Unknown host repo.maven.apache.org: Name or service not known -> [Help 1]
-
Creating a new project in RHPAM 7.5.0 fails if not connected to the internet:
ERROR [org.guvnor.common.services.backend.exceptions.ExceptionUtilities] (default task-1) Exception thrown: org.apache.maven.project.ProjectBuildingException: 1 problem was encountered while building the effective model [FATAL] Non-readable POM : input contained no data @
Environment
- Red Hat Process Automation Manager (RHPAM)
- 7.5.0.GA
- Red Hat Decision Manager (RHDM)
- 7.5.0.GA
